NEE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

2,702 of the 7,595 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in NextEra Energy (NEE)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$117B — down 2.2% from $119B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 172 funds opened new NEE positions and 167 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 1,191 added to existing stakes and 1,012 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ital Research Global Investors, adding an estimated $779M. The largest seller was Norges Bank, cutting an estimated $1.06B.
